网站更新内容:请访问: https://bigdata.ministep.cn/

pandas多列变一列或者多行变一行

pandas多列变一列或者多行变一行

合并重复的行

queryset = read_query_sql_cloud(query_sql)
df = pd.DataFrame(queryset)
def formatRecords(g):
    result = []
    item=g.to_dict()
    result=pd.DataFrame(item).to_dict("records")
    return result

df_dict = df.groupby('category').apply(lambda g: formatRecords(g)).reset_index(name='node_items')
df_dict

posted @ 2022-06-20 20:47  ministep88  阅读(382)  评论(0编辑  收藏  举报
网站更新内容:请访问:https://bigdata.ministep.cn/